|
| This Article | ||
| ||
| Share | ||
| Bibliographic References | ||
| Add to: | ||
| | ||
| Search | ||
| ||
| ASCII Text | x | ||
| Arnold L. Rosenberg, Matthew Yurkewych, "Guidelines for Scheduling Some Common Computation-Dags for Internet-Based Computing," IEEE Transactions on Computers, vol. 54, no. 4, pp. 428-438, April, 2005. | |||
| BibTex | x | ||
| @article{ 10.1109/TC.2005.65, author = {Arnold L. Rosenberg and Matthew Yurkewych}, title = {Guidelines for Scheduling Some Common Computation-Dags for Internet-Based Computing}, journal ={IEEE Transactions on Computers}, volume = {54}, number = {4}, issn = {0018-9340}, year = {2005}, pages = {428-438}, doi = {http://doi.ieeecomputersociety.org/10.1109/TC.2005.65}, publisher = {IEEE Computer Society}, address = {Los Alamitos, CA, USA}, } | |||
| RefWorks Procite/RefMan/Endnote | x | ||
| TY - JOUR JO - IEEE Transactions on Computers TI - Guidelines for Scheduling Some Common Computation-Dags for Internet-Based Computing IS - 4 SN - 0018-9340 SP428 EP438 EPD - 428-438 A1 - Arnold L. Rosenberg, A1 - Matthew Yurkewych, PY - 2005 KW - Internet-based computing KW - grid computing KW - global computing KW - Web computing KW - scheduling KW - reduction computations KW - convolutional computations KW - mesh-structured computations KW - tree-structured computations. VL - 54 JA - IEEE Transactions on Computers ER - | |||
[1] K. Aberer and Z. Despotovic, “Managing Trust in a Peer-2-Peer Information System,” Proc. 10th Intl Conf. Information and Knowledge Management, 2001.
[2] V.E. Beneš, “Optimal Rearrangeable Multistage Connecting Networks,” Bell System Technical J., vol. 43, pp. 1641-1656, 1964.
[3] S.N. Bhatt, F.R.K. Chung, F.T. Leighton, and A.L. Rosenberg, “Scheduling Tree-Dags Using FIFO Queues: A Control-Memory Tradeoff,” J. Parallel and Distributed Computing, vol. 33, pp. 55-68, 1996.
[4] S.N. Bhatt, F.R.K. Chung, J.-W. Hong, F.T. Leighton, B. Obrenić, A.L. Rosenberg, and E.J. Schwabe, “Optimal Emulations by Butterfly-Like Networks,” J. ACM, vol. 43, pp. 293-330, 1996.
[5] R. Buyya, D. Abramson, and J. Giddy, “A Case for Economy Grid Architecture for Service Oriented Grid Computing,” Proc. 10th Heterogeneous Computing Workshop, 2001.
[6] W. Cirne and K. Marzullo, “The Computational Co-Op: Gathering Clusters into a Metacomputer,” Proc. 13th Int'l Parallel Processing Symp., pp. 160-166, 1999.
[7] S.A. Cook, “An Observation on Time-Storage Tradeoff,” J. Computer Systems and Sciences, vol. 9, pp. 308-316, 1974.
[8] T.H. Cormen, C.E. Leiserson, R.L. Rivest, and C. Stein, Introduction to Algorithms, second ed. Cambridge, Mass.: MIT Press, 1999.
[9] The Grid: Blueprint for a New Computing Infrastructure, I. Foster and C. Kesselman, eds. San Francisco: Morgan-Kaufmann, 1999.
[10] I. Foster, C. Kesselman, and S. Tuecke, “The Anatomy of the Grid: Enabling Scalable Virtual Organizations,” Int'l J. Supercomputer Applications, 2001.
[11] L.-X. Gao, A.L. Rosenberg, and R.K. Sitaraman, “Optimal Clustering of Tree-Sweep Computations for High-Latency Parallel Environments,” IEEE Trans. Parallel and Distributed Systems, vol. 10, pp. 813-824, 1999.
[12] M.R. Garey, R.L. Graham, D.S. Johnson, and D.E. Knuth, “Complexity Results for Bandwidth Minimization,” SIAM J. Applied Math., vol. 34, pp. 477-495, 1978.
[13] A. Gerasoulis and T. Yang, “A Comparison of Clustering Heuristics for Scheduling Dags on Multiprocessors,” J. Parallel and Distributed Computing, vol. 16, pp. 276-291, 1992.
[14] P. Golle and I. Mironov, “Uncheatable Distributed Computations,” Proc. RSA Conf. 2001 (Cryptographers' Track), 2001.
[15] L. He, Z. Han, H. Jin, L. Pan, and S. Li, “DAG-Based Parallel Real Time Task Scheduling Algorithm on a Cluster,” Proc. Int'l Conf. Parallel and Distributed Processing Techniques and Applications (PDPTA 2000), pp. 437-443, 2000.
[16] J.-W. Hong and H.T. Kung, “I/O Complexity: The Red-Blue Pebble Game,” Proc. 13th ACM Symp. Theory of Computing, pp. 326-333, 1981.
[17] The Intel Philanthropic Peer-to-Peer program. www.intel.comcure, 2001.
[18] A. Jakoby and R. Reischuk, “The Complexity of Scheduling Problems with Communication Delays for Trees,” Proc. Scandinavian Workshop Algorithmic Theory, pp. 163-177, 1992.
[19] R.M. Karp, A. Sahay, E. Santos, and K.E. Schauser, “Optimal Broadcast and Summation in the logP Model,” Proc. Fifth ACM Symp. Parallel Algorithms and Architectures, pp. 142-153, 1993.
[20] D. Kondo, H. Casanova, E. Wing, and F. Berman, “Models and Scheduling Guidelines for Global Computing Applications,” Proc. Int'l Parallel and Distributed Processing Symp. (IPDPS '02), 2002.
[21] E. Korpela, D. Werthimer, D. Anderson, J. Cobb, and M. Lebofsky, “SETI@home: Massively Distributed Computing for SETI,” Computing in Science and Eng., P.F. Dubois, ed., Los Alamitos, Calif.: IEEE CS Press, 2000.
[22] J.K. Lenstra, M. Veldhorst, and B. Veltman, “The Complexity of Scheduling Trees with Communication Delays,” J. Algorithms, vol. 20, pp. 157-173, 1996.
[23] B.M. Maggs and R.K. Sitaraman, “Simple Algorithms for Routing on Butterfly Networks with Bounded Queues,” SIAM J. Computing, vol. 28, pp. 984-1004, 1999.
[24] The Olson Laboratory Fight AIDS@Home Project, www.fightaids athome.org, 2001.
[25] M.S. Paterson and C.E. Hewitt, “Comparative Schematology,” Proc. Project MAC Conf. Concurrent Systems and Parallel Computation, pp. 119-127, 1970.
[26] A.G. Ranade, “Optimal Speedup for Backtrack Search on a Butterfly Network,” Math. Systems Theory, vol. 27, pp. 85-101, 1994.
[27] A.L. Rosenberg, “Accountable Web-Computing,” IEEE Trans. Parallel and Distributed Systems, vol. 14, pp. 97-106, 2003.
[28] A.L. Rosenberg, “On Scheduling Mesh-Structured Computations for Internet-Based Computing,” IEEE Trans. Computers, vol. 53, pp. 1176-1186, 2004.
[29] A.L. Rosenberg and I.H. Sudborough, “Bandwidth and Pebbling,” Computing, vol. 31, pp. 115-139, 1983.
[30] X.-H. Sun and M. Wu, “GHS: A Performance Prediction and Task Scheduling System for Grid Computing,” Proc. IEEE Int'l Parallel and Distributed Processing Symp., 2003.

